Lost Orbi RBR40
I recently moved and lost my RBR40 router but still have the two RBS40 satellites. Is there a place to just buy the RBR40 router or is there another Orbi router that I can buy that will work with the RBS40 satellites?
Thanks in advance for your help!
- Mark as New
- Bookmark
- Subscribe
- Subscribe to RSS Feed
- Permalink
- Report Inappropriate Content
Re: Lost Orbi RBR40
We don't sell the RBR40, however we do sell the RBR20, which will work just fine with the 2 satellites.
-Orbi Product Management
